Although, this model is somewhat different, in that it does not have automatic opening doors, but rather manual doors and passive tilt instead of automatic.  Maybe that's enough of a difference for Lionel to say its not the same.

Different? Yes, I think so, but as in not nearly as ambitious. That is probably a sign of the times.

As I remember it, the Acela Lionel cataloged a few years back, and then cancelled, had automatic doors, which were said at the time to be based on Lionel's new subway door technology, including wired connections rather than IR. What it did not have was any tilt feature.

Well, the tilt seems to be back but as a "passive" which I take to mean only works when you trigger it. That sounds a lot like my original issue Acela, where the tilt has only ever worked in "demo" mode when the train is not moving - or at least I detect no tilt at all when the set is running on my room-sized oval.
